explain the differences between a structural formula, a condensed structural formula, a carbon skeleton formula, a ball-and-stick model, and a space-filling model.

Answers

A structural formula depicts the bonds between the atoms using lines. Most or all of the bonds are omitted in a condensed structural formula. A structural formula identifies the atoms in a molecule. It also demonstrates how they are related to one another.

A condensed structural formula is a method of writing organic structures so that they can be typed in a single line of text.It depicts all atoms but excludes vertical bonds and most or all horizontal bonds.Parentheses in a condensed structural formula indicate that polyatomic groups within a formula are attached to the nearest non-hydrogen atom on the left.

A carbon skeleton can be made up entirely of carbon-hydrogen bonds, as in propane: Propane is made up of three carbon atoms that are held together by single bonds. Propane's chemical formula is C3H8 C 3 H 8. There are four types of carbon skeletons. Skeletons are commonly found as branched, straight chain, or rings. Carbon skeletons can be drawn with or without the presence of atom letters. Carbon skeletons represent a molecule's diversity.

The ball and stick model is a molecular model in which spheres and rods are used to depict a molecule. The spheres represent the atoms of the molecule, and the rods represent the chemical bonds that connect the atoms. These are three-dimensional designs. This model can also be used to represent double and triple bonds.

A space-filling model is a molecular model in which spheres are used to represent a molecule. Unlike the ball and stick model, this model only uses spheres to represent atoms; no rods are used to represent chemical bonds between atoms. The spheres are instead full-sized. In this model, the sphere radii are proportional to the atom radii.

what is atomic radius a. draw lithium and sodium as compare them b. what is an electron shell? how do we know how many of these are? c. what happens as more electrons and shells are added to an atom? d. summarize the trend and why

Answers

a. Atomic radius is a measure of the size of an atom, typically defined as the distance from the center of the nucleus to the outermost valence electron.

b. An electron shell is a region of space around the nucleus of an atom where electrons are most likely to be found.

c. As more electrons and shells are added to an atom, the overall size of the atom increases.

d. The trend in atomic radius is that it generally decreases as we go across a period (from left to right) and increases as we go down a group (from top to bottom) on the periodic table.

Lithium and sodium are both alkali metals and have similar electronic structures, with one valence electron in the outermost electron shell. They differ in the number of protons and neutrons in their nuclei, which affects the overall size of the atom. Lithium has three protons and four neutrons in its nucleus, while sodium has 11 protons and 12 neutrons. As a result, sodium is larger than lithium, with a larger atomic radius.

When more electrons and shells are added to an atom, it will increasing the atom size. This is because the additional electrons are farther from the nucleus and contribute to the overall size of the atom. Additionally, as more electron shells are added, the shielding effect of the inner electrons increases, which means that the outer electrons experience less attraction to the nucleus and are therefore less tightly bound. This can also contribute to the overall size of the atom.

Atomic radius is that it generally decreases as we go across a period (from left to right) and increases as we go down a group (from top to bottom) on the periodic table. This is because as we go across a period, the number of protons in the nucleus increases, which increases the overall positive charge and attracts the valence electrons more strongly. This causes the valence electrons to be more closely bound to the nucleus, leading to a smaller atomic radius. As we go down a group, the number of electron shells increases, which increases the size of the atom overall. Additionally, the outermost valence electrons are farther from the nucleus and experience less attraction, which also contributes to the overall increase in size.

a mixture of 5.00 moles of neon and 3.00 moles of nitrogen occupy a volume of 36.0 l in a vessel where the total pressure is 6.00 atm. what is the partial pressure of the neon in the container?

Answers

The partial pressure of the neon that is contained in a container is 3.75 atm.

The given parameters are written as follows:

No. of moles of Ne , n = 5 mol

No. of moles of N2 , n' = 3 mol

Total pressure , P = 6 atm

The mole fraction of any component of a mixture is the ratio of the number of moles of that substance to the total number of moles of all substances present. In a mixture of gases, the partial pressure of each gas is the product of the total pressure and the mole fraction of that gas.

Mole fraction of Ne , X = n / (n+n' )

                                  = 0.625

Mole fraction of N2 , X' = n' / (n+n' )

                                    = 0.375

Partial pressure of Ne , p = X * P

                                     = 0.625 * 6

                                     = 3.75 atm
